(Mechanics and Farmers Bank Abstract Sculpture), (sculpture).
Artist:
Shrady, Frederick Charles, 1907-1990, sculptor.
Kuharec, Drago, fabricator.
Lyons, Thomas, architect.
Drago Metal Art Industries, fabricator.
Lyons, Mather & Lechner, architectural firm.
Title:
(Mechanics and Farmers Bank Abstract Sculpture), (sculpture).
Dates:
1970. Dedicated June 29, 1970.
Digital Reference:
Medium:
Bronze sheets.
Dimensions:
Approx. 14 x 10 x 1 ft. (800 lbs.).
Description:
An abstract sculpture of a ship's sail, pennant, and rigging, affixed to the facade of a building.

Owner:
Administered by Mechanics & Farmers Bank, Consolidated Asset Recovery, 961 Main Street, Bridgeport, Connecticut 06604
Located 930 Main Street, Bridgeport, Connecticut
Remarks:
Title supplied by Inventory cataloger.
The sculpture was fabricated with the assistance of Drago Kuharec and Drago Metal Art Industries. Thomas Lyons of Lyons, Mather & Lechner was the architect responsible for the 1970 wing of the building. Mechanics & Farmers Bank was formerly known as Mechanics & Farmers Savings Bank. IAS files contain a related article from the Bridgeport Post, May 3, 1970. For additional information see: David W. Palmquist's "Bridgeport: A Pictorial History," Virginia Beach, VA: The Donning Company, 1981, pg. 79, 107.
